The Lamine Baptist Association, established in 1872, is a fellowship of Baptist churches located in central Missouri, primarily serving Morgan, Cooper, and Camden counties. Rooted in the traditions of the Southern Baptist Convention and the Missouri Baptist Convention, the association was formed by churches from the western half of the Concord Association. Over the years, it has included congregations from Miller, Moniteau, Pettis, and Benton counties, focusing on collective efforts to spread the teachings of the Baptist faith and serve their communities.

Today, the Lamine Baptist Association continues its mission by providing resources and support to member churches, fostering spiritual growth, and organizing events such as children's and youth camps. With a dedicated leadership team and a commitment to unity and cooperation, the association works together to fulfill its purpose of serving the Lord through collective efforts.
